Learn basic woodworking skills while making a decorative lantern out of reclaimed wood and recycled leather. This workshop is perfect for anyone interested in learning some woodworking skills but doesn't have a lot of space in their home for a large project, like a table or bench. In this workshop you will learn to use the miter saw (chopsaw) and brad nail guns to make a small but beautiful decoration for you home. Place an LED tea light inside to add a warm touch.
Wood and leather are included in the cost of the class. If you are interested in staining your lantern, you will need to bring stain with you.
